MARSHALL COUNTY, Ind. – The Indiana Department of Transportation (INDOT) announced that there will be a rebuilding of a railroad crossing on State Road 17 in Marshall County.
A road closure at the crossing will go into effect on Tuesday and the road is anticipated to reopen on September 10.
The specific crossing is in Burr Oak.
Southbound drivers on SR 17 will be detoured west on State Road 8, south on State Road 23 and east on State Road 10 back to SR 17.
Northbound drivers on SR 17 will be detoured west on SR 10, north on SR 23 and east on SR 8 back to SR 17.
